At Amartha, we are on the lookout for an Engineering Manager/Lead to spearhead an enthusiastic team of software engineers. In this pivotal role, you will be involved in every aspect of the engineering process, from backlog grooming and sprint planning to conducting code reviews that help elevate our code quality. Collaborating with the Head of Engineering, you'll dive into system design discussions that shape our tech landscape, while also taking charge of incident management through proactive and preventive initiatives. With a focus on driving technical projects, you will contribute hands-on by owning services and enhancing our development processes. You’ll interface closely with our product management team and business stakeholders to navigate product requirements and feedback. Bringing at least five years of experience in the financial technology sector will help you excel here, and we value fast learners with strong analytical skills. If you've got advanced knowledge of Go and have touched upon architectural patterns for high-scale web applications, that's a plus! Familiarity with both SQL and NoSQL database systems and a systematic approach to problem-solving are essential. We're dedicated to not only improving code but also investing in our team's growth by cultivating a diverse and inclusive environment. If you’re passionate about TDD, refactoring large systems, and utilizing event-driven architecture — especially if you have experience with tools like Kafka, Kubernetes, Grafana, or Prometheus — we invite you to explore this exciting opportunity with us at Amartha.
